Its small rooms, lighted only by narrow windows, heated only by fireplaces, badly ventilated, and provided with little furniture, must have been indeed cheerless. Dark and gloomy rooms, lit and heated by suffocatingly smoky fires, were par for the course.

So are pantries and larders. Castles were also the hubs of rural communities where a lord administered the local economy, conducted courts, and provided such essential services as milling grain. Daily life in a medieval castle was filled with a constant hubbub of busied work in the kitchens, preparations for celebrations in the great hall, and religious worship in each castle’s own chapel.
